
Ricky Weir promotes grassroots football and memoir in Nigeria
Former Jersey Football Association president Ricky Weir is deepening his involvement in Nigerian grassroots football. On his latest visit, he promoted his memoir and supported youth and Walking Football programmes. Weir, who now holds a Nigerian passport, attended league openings in Abuja and Lagos, and received special honours for his contributions. His memoir, “Illegitimately Blessed,” explores his journey discovering his Nigerian heritage and aims to inspire others.

- Ricky Weir returned to Nigeria to promote his memoir and support grassroots football initiatives.
- He attended the 5Stars Premier League opening in Abuja, delivering new footballs to all sixteen teams.
- Weir officiated at the Walking Football league opening in Surulere, Lagos, and praised the growth of the discipline since its introduction in 2020.
- During his visit, he was honoured by the Africa Illustrious Awards in Lagos as an African Football Ambassador.
- His memoir, “Illegitimately Blessed,” was self-published in September 2024 and later won a literary award in Italy.
